A guide to uninstall AMD Settings from your PC

You can find on this page detailed information on how to remove AMD Settings for Windows. It was created for Windows by Advanced Micro Devices, Inc.. More information about Advanced Micro Devices, Inc. can be seen here. Click on to get more details about AMD Settings on Advanced Micro Devices, Inc.'s website. AMD Settings is frequently set up in the C:\Program Files (x86)\AMD directory, however this location can vary a lot depending on the user's option while installing the application. CLIStart.exe is the AMD Settings's main executable file and it occupies close to 749.20 KB (767176 bytes) on disk.

AMD Settings is composed of the following executables which take 21.64 MB (22687720 bytes) on disk:
